Keep your bird entertained and engaged with this Handmade Parrot Foot Toy Assortment. Designed to encourage natural chewing, tossing, carrying, and foot play, these colourful toys provide valuable daily enrichment for companion parrots.
Each foot toy is individually handcrafted using a variety of parrot-safe materials including natural wood pieces, wooden beads, colourful wooden shapes, rope, and bird-safe components. The different textures, colours, and shapes help stimulate curiosity while satisfying your bird's natural desire to chew, manipulate, and explore objects with its feet and beak.
Foot toys are an excellent way to provide mental stimulation and reduce boredom, particularly for intelligent parrots that enjoy holding and playing with objects. They encourage activity and help promote healthy play behaviours while providing a fun outlet for natural chewing instincts.
Every assortment is unique. Due to the handmade nature of these toys, sizes, colours, wood types, shapes, and designs will vary. No two assortments will be exactly alike.
These foot toys measure approximately 5 inches x 3 inches, although sizes may vary slightly. Suitable for many small to medium parrots including Cockatiels, Lovebirds, Conures, Quakers, Caiques, Senegal Parrots, Parrotlets, and similar-sized birds.
